RES. 86 Providing for congressional disapproval under chapter 8 of title 5, United States Code, of the rule submitted by the United States Fish and Wildlife Service relating to ``Endangered and Threatened Wildlife and Plants; Regulations for Interagency Cooperation''. _______________________________________________________________________ IN THE SENATE OF THE UNITED STATES May 16, 2024 Mr. Sullivan (for himself, Ms. Lummis, Mr. Ricketts, Mrs. Capito, Mr. Daines, Mr. Lee, Mr. Barrasso, Mr. Risch, Mr. Rounds, Mrs. Britt, Mr. Wicker, Mr. Crapo, Mrs. Blackburn, Mr. Marshall, and Mr. Hoeven) introduced the following joint resolution; which was read twice and referred to the Committee on Environment and Public Works _______________________________________________________________________ JOINT RESOLUTION Providing for congressional disapproval under chapter 8 of title 5, United States Code, of the rule submitted by the United States Fish and Wildlife Service relating to ``Endangered and Threatened Wildlife and Plants; Regulations for Interagency Cooperation''. Resolved by the Senate and House of Representatives of the United States of America in Congress assembled, That Congress disapproves the rule submitted by the United States Fish and Wildlife Service relating to ``Endangered and Threatened Wildlife and Plants; Regulations for Interagency Cooperation'' (89 Fed. Reg. 24268 (April 5, 2024)), and such rule shall have no force or effect. <all>
